Position Summary:

The position of Brand Manager Immunology is expected to actively manage the Immunology biosimilar portfolio of Celltrion. The position holder is required to bring a solid brand manager skillset as well as an expertise in any or all of the therapeutic areas relevant for the brand. Previous experience in the biosimilars area is a plus.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Develop and plan appropriate local brand/marketing activities for therapeutic areas based on, if applicable, global brand operating plan and aligned to relevant customer and country operating plans:
  • Build and execute local business plans for respective therapeutic area of brand, aligned with global marketing strategy
  • Develop and execute brand/marketing activities and programs, identifying brand issues and objectives for each targeted customer group and defining programs to address these
  • Direct creative and media agency as well as other external vendors to build a cohesive, highly engaging customer brand experience according to marketing strategy and tactics
  • Identify and develop innovative marketing approaches, challenging the status quo, to successfully differentiate our brands
  • Lead congress and event planning and execution on a national and pan-regional level
  • Challenge cross-functionally field force colleagues for customer and market insights, while providing appropriate responses to their feedback on brand materials and leveraging their market expertise
  • Actively drive and initiate continuous education of field force to ensure and enhance implementation and accuracy of customer programs
  • Ensure tight control of operational expenses per brand activity
  • Critically evaluate initiatives and programs based on SMART KPIs
  • Lead cross-functional oncology brand team meetings with responsibility for generation of brand insights, prioritization and balancing of brand related programs and materials
  • Ensure consistency and alignment of operational activities with other therapeutic area(s) or brands

Company Summary:

Celltrion Healthcare conducts worldwide marketing, sales, and distribution of biological medicines through an extensive global network that spans more than 120 different countries. Celltrion Healthcare provides REMSIMA, the world's first biosimilar monoclonal antibody (mAb) approved by the European Medicines Agency (EMA) for the treatment of autoimmune disease, and innovative biopharmaceutical medications to help increase patient access to advanced therapies around the world. Celltrion Healthcare believes that every patient deserves access to treatments they need. Based on this belief, Celltrion Healthcare has been steadfast in our mission to meet the needs of patients who previously had limited access to advanced therapeutics, since our inception in 1999.

What We Do

Celltrion is a leading global biopharmaceutical company headquartered in Incheon, South Korea. It specializes in the research, development, manufacturing, marketing, and sales of biosimilars and innovative therapeutics. The company is dedicated to improving patient access to advanced medications through its fully integrated model, which encompasses the entire process from research and development to clinical trials, regulatory affairs, production, and global distribution.
